Tung OilTung oil also called Wood Oil, or China Wood Oil, is a pale-yellow, pungent drying oil obtained from the seeds of the tung tree. On long standing or on heating, tung oil polymerizes to a hard, waterproof gel that is highly resistant to acids and alkalis. It is used in quick-drying varnishes and paints, as a waterproofing agent, and in making linoleum, oilcloth, and insulating compounds. Tung oil is produced chiefly in China from the tung tree (Aleurites fordii).
The tung tree also called tung oil tree (Aleurites fordii), is a small Asian tree of the spurge family (Euphorbiaceae), commercially valuable for tung oil, which is extracted from its nut like seeds. In the Orient tung oil was traditionally used for lighting, but it also has important modern industrial uses.
